Ready Reckoner Rates in Bandivali, Mumbai
FY 2026-27 · Official ASR rates published by Maharashtra Government
| Zone Code | Description | Residential | Office | Shop |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 51/Land/245 | Village boundary to the north, railway line to the east, village boundary to the south and west. | ₹1,10,010/sqm | ₹1,26,510/sqm | ₹1,80,000/sqm |
| 51/Land/245A | Properties included below | ₹1,22,650/sqm | ₹1,41,050/sqm | ₹1,66,500/sqm |
| 51/Land/245B | Property under Lodha project. | ₹1,54,010/sqm | ₹1,77,110/sqm | ₹1,92,510/sqm |
| 51/Land/246 | Village boundary to the north, east and south and railway line to the west. | ₹1,05,950/sqm | ₹1,21,850/sqm | ₹1,51,200/sqm |
| 51/Road/244 | Swami Vivekananda Marg. | ₹1,22,100/sqm | ₹1,40,420/sqm | ₹1,83,800/sqm |
Source: Annual Statement of Rates (ASR) FY 2026-27, Maharashtra Government
What is the Ready Reckoner Rate?
The Ready Reckoner Rate (also called the Circle Rate or ASR rate) is the minimum property value set by the Maharashtra government for calculating stamp duty and registration fees. Every property transaction in Mumbai must use at least this rate for stamp duty computation.
How is stamp duty calculated?
Stamp duty = ASR rate × Built-up Area (BUA) × floor rise multiplier. BUA = RERA carpet area × 1.10 (new properties). Floor premiums apply from the 5th floor onwards. See our step-by-step guide for the full formula.
